Fanshawe students offer off-campus housing guidelines

News Date: Aug 20, 2008
2 Fanshawe College students have come up with 7 recommendations to improve off-campus housing, especially in areas where out-of-control parties and vandalism are frequent. The students found that an isolated, "jail-like" area correlates with partying because there isn't anything else for students to do. They recommend off-campus students have better access to amenities and areas for socializing, as well as instituting residence advisers to plan activities. The students also suggest more involvement from the City of London, police, and schools. London Free Press | A-News (video)
